Taylor’s Golden Age, 50YO Tawny, bottled in 2022. A delicious caramelised orange on the nose, sweet yet also balanced by a little acidity. Balanced entry with an attractive palate. Nicely constructed, with an elegance lacking on some of the Single Harvest Tawnies tasted alongside this wine. Good acidity with a nicely balanced set of flavours, brown apple and caramel finish. Deliciously put together, full of honeyed fruit and showing nicely. Rather sweet on the finish though; perhaps not a wine which could be drunk more than a glass or two at a time. 93/100. Tasted 16-May-2024.

Taylor 50 Year Old Tawny Port "Golden Age". Med dark tawny with a greening rim. Butterscotch, caramel, dried apricot, and light brown sugar are the primary notes on the nose. Rich and smooth palate - not as bold as expected. Very nice and easy to drink, but lacks depth and power for a 50. Still, 95 points for just being fabulous.

40% opacity, brown-orange, amber rim. Almond and butterscotch on the nose. Fresh and lively, seville oranges, good length, nicely balanced acidity.
